Output 4ac5efd83ede7cdf6469bef6efe1e79db19ef481ca42a8d7a4f162be2c6b6aa4:5

value
310470180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ae95c0fa4810af9a4952a9cbb33f0d17b2891a61 OP_EQUAL
address
3Hc8tzxGP1hhnfY6WfuYnDRXgTireTrDmJ
transaction
4ac5efd83ede7cdf6469bef6efe1e79db19ef481ca42a8d7a4f162be2c6b6aa4
confirmations
319442
spent
true